Diploma in Digital Electronics Engineering Syllabus
First Year
Basic Electronics
Electronic Devices & Circuits
Digital Logic Design
Engineering Mathematics I
Engineering Physics
Engineering Chemistry
Environmental Studies
Second Year
Digital Electronics
Microprocessors
Electronic Measurements & Instrumentation
Engineering Mathematics II
Communication Systems
Network Information Theory
Embedded Systems
Third Year
Advanced Digital Electronics
Microcontrollers Fundamentals and Applications with PIC
VLSI Design
Digital Signal Processing
Control Systems
Digital Communication
Electronic System Design

Embedded Systems
Embedded Systems combine electronics and programmable control within specialised systems and devices.
Students study applicable theoretical concepts associated with embedded technologies and their role within modern electronic systems.
VLSI Design
VLSI Design introduces theoretical concepts associated with integrated electronic systems and semiconductor technologies.
The subject provides structured exposure to advanced Digital Electronics concepts relevant to modern electronic systems.
Digital Signal Processing
Digital Signal Processing introduces theoretical concepts related to the representation and processing of signals in digital systems.
Students build applicable theoretical understanding that connects electronics, signals, communication and digital technologies.
Digital Communication
Digital Communication provides theoretical exposure to concepts associated with the transmission and processing of digital information.
The subject complements earlier learning in Communication Systems, Digital Electronics and Digital Signal Processing.
